a.There is established in the General Fund a special dedicated fund to be known as the New Jersey Emergency Medical Service Helicopter Response Program Fund which shall be administered by the State Treasurer. The Treasurer shall credit to the fund all moneys received pursuant to section 1 of P.L.1992, c.87 (C.39:3-8.2). Any interest earned on moneys in the fund shall be credited to the fund.
b.From the moneys in the fund there shall be annually appropriated an amount necessary to pay the reasonable and necessary expenses of the operation of the New Jersey Emergency Medical Service Helicopter Response Program created pursuant to P.L.1986, c.106 (C.26:2K-35 et al.).
